Thursday, December 14, 2006

By "thumbs down" she means "put them to death"

Le Monde Al-Jazeera shreiks "Le Pen's new style well accepted by the French". As if the old style wasn't. The French preSS continues to conveniently forget that the Front National was the number two French political party in the presidential election of 2002, finishing ahead of the beloved Socialists.

